1 Corinthians 14 : 7 [ NET ]
14:7. It is similar for lifeless things that make a sound, like a flute or harp. Unless they make a distinction in the notes, how can what is played on the flute or harp be understood?
1 Corinthians 14 : 7 [ NLT ]
14:7. Even lifeless instruments like the flute or the harp must play the notes clearly, or no one will recognize the melody.
1 Corinthians 14 : 7 [ ASV ]
14:7. Even things without life, giving a voice, whether pipe or harp, if they give not a distinction in the sounds, how shall it be known what is piped or harped?
1 Corinthians 14 : 7 [ ESV ]
14:7. If even lifeless instruments, such as the flute or the harp, do not give distinct notes, how will anyone know what is played?
1 Corinthians 14 : 7 [ KJV ]
14:7. And even things without life giving sound, whether pipe or harp, except they give a distinction in the sounds, how shall it be known what is piped or harped?
1 Corinthians 14 : 7 [ RSV ]
14:7. If even lifeless instruments, such as the flute or the harp, do not give distinct notes, how will any one know what is played?
1 Corinthians 14 : 7 [ RV ]
14:7. Even things without life, giving a voice, whether pipe or harp, if they give not a distinction in the sounds, how shall it be known what is piped or harped?
1 Corinthians 14 : 7 [ YLT ]
14:7. yet the things without life giving sound -- whether pipe or harp -- if a difference in the sounds they may not give, how shall be known that which is piped or that which is harped?
1 Corinthians 14 : 7 [ ERVEN ]
14:7. This is true even with lifeless things that make sounds—like a flute or a harp. If the different musical notes are not made clear, you can't understand what song is being played. Each note must be played clearly for you to be able to understand the tune.
1 Corinthians 14 : 7 [ WEB ]
14:7. Even things without life, giving a voice, whether pipe or harp, if they didn\'t give a distinction in the sounds, how would it be known what is piped or harped?
